In a Facebook Group that I follow, there is some talk about other passenger's charges showing up on their account, because of the medallion.  Is this really an issue with the medallion?

 

We're looking forward to our first Medallion cruise in April on the Sky 😀


Thanks.

Yes there were several folks on here that stated if they walked up to the bar or past it if the ipad picked up their medallion and the bartender didnt pay attention they got charges not theirs.  Some were saying in the casino as well.  I know on our last one we had to now tap the medallion to the fob they had at the stores and for bingo.  So that may have been the new remedy to not allow the ipads pick up the signal but rather have the guests tap their medallions to buy the items including drinks at the bar.  We only did our 1 free drink and didnt not pass by the bars but still checked our accounts just in case every couple of days for unwanted charges. 

Link to comment
Share on other sites

1 hour ago, cruzrbachoua said:

Yes there were several folks on here that stated if they walked up to the bar or past it if the ipad picked up their medallion and the bartender didnt pay attention they got charges not theirs.  Some were saying in the casino as well.  I know on our last one we had to now tap the medallion to the fob they had at the stores and for bingo.  So that may have been the new remedy to not allow the ipads pick up the signal but rather have the guests tap their medallions to buy the items including drinks at the bar.  We only did our 1 free drink and didnt not pass by the bars but still checked our accounts just in case every couple of days for unwanted charges. 

The way it works at the bar and when ordering from someone with the medallion reader. You actually have to just about touch the reader on the bar. It will then change colors around the circle and read your medallion. The bar tender will give you a nod that it read it. Just walking past it will in no way register it at the bar.

Bunch of miss information.
